Beginning Knitting Series in Reno April 1+8+15+22

Join knit-wear designer Gudrun Johnston in this four-part beginner knitting class. Participants will master basic stitches and learn about yarn, needles, and pattern reading. This class is intended for individuals who have never held knitting needles or for those who learned many years ago. Because all of us move at a different pace, the class descriptions outlined below are very loose guidelines to what we hope to cover in each session.

APRIL 1
basic knitting vocabulary, tools, casting on, knit stitch

APRIL 8
purl stitch, fixing dropped stitches, casting off

APRIL 15
gauge and why it’s important, shaping by increasing or decreasing stitches

APRIL 22
getting familiar with following knitting patterns, picking out the right size needles and type of yarn for a project
